ONE of Emmerdale’s newest stars has been spotted on set for the first time â and he couldn’t look happier.
Bradley Riches, who has joined the ITV soap in a mysterious new role, was seen beaming as he made his way to work.
The Celebrity Big Brother star was dressed in a baby blue cardigan and black trousers.
The 22-year-old posed with his arms open indicating the famous Emmerdale sign before heading to film his first scenes.
Bradley is best known for playing James McEwan in Netflix’s Heartstopper.
The actor is set to make his first Emmerdale appearance in May.
His character’s identity remains a closely guarded secret, but insiders have teased that he has a connection to a major character and will stir up plenty of drama in the village.
Speaking about his new role, Bradley said: “I’m beyond excited to be joining Emmerdale! It’s a real bucket list moment for me, especially since it was my grandad’s favourite soap – I just know he’d be over the moon.
“Everyone has been so lovely and welcoming, and the village is even more amazing in real life.
“I absolutely love my character (though I can’t spill too much just yet!), and I’m just so grateful for this opportunity. I can’t wait for everyone to see what’s in store...”;
Emmerdale producer Laura Shaw added: “We are absolutely thrilled to welcome Bradley to the Emmerdale family.
“Bradley brings a wealth of talent, and his warmth, wit, and charisma make him perfect for this new role.
“We have some wonderful stories for him to play, and we can't wait for the audience to see Bradley bring his new character bursting into life on screen.”;
While fans are excited to see him join the soap, Bradley has also had to deal with online abuse since his casting was announced.
He took to Instagram to hit back at trolls, saying: “Some of the comments and messages I’ve received are vile. Too many people are quick to judge me regarding my sexuality or being autistic, without thinking about the impact of their words.
“But lucky for you, I won’t be behind a screen... I will be on YOUR SCREEN! If you’re mad, stay mad! See you soon x.”;
